About us. Epiroc is a global productivity partner for mining & construction customers and accelerates the transformation toward a sustainable society. With ground-breaking technology, we develop and provide innovative and safe equipment, such as drill rigs, rock excavation and construction equipment and tools for surface and underground applications. We also offer world-class service and other aftermarket support as well as solutions for automation, digitalization and electrification. Our global headquarters is based in Örebro, Sweden and we have around 18,000 passionate employees supporting and collaborating with customers in over 150 countries around the world. Join Our Team as a Product Manager SRD Automation at Epiroc! 

 

Your Mission:  

 

 

The Product Manager is expected to provide strong leadership to the organization in terms of professional conduct, business culture and product knowledge. The Product Manager is to be the product and sales champion for the business line’s products within Canada by supporting the Branches, Account Managers and the Business Line Manager with application specific knowledge and recommendations for equipment. By increasing knowledge of the Canadian market and Epiroc’s place in it, will be able to provide products required to meet current and future customer demand.

 

Responsibilities: 

 

  • Responsible for the Surface drill and truck automation product and projects within Canada
  • Directly supports the Surface Drilling Business Line Managers for the customer’s technology needs
  • Work directly with Automation Product Managers at the factory for:
    • Knowledge and understanding of new and existing products
    • Orders requiring special needs
    • Large project reviews and cooperation
    • New capability/product testing and feedback
    • Feedback on metrics of employed automation
  • Acts as liaison between customer and product company for problem resolution
  • Works with communications personnel for article creation, expo planning, and speaking engagements.
  • Responsible for mine technology integration efforts; to include project planning and interfacing with the customer; seeing it through to successful implementation.
  • Ensure customer center orders to product company are configured with correct Rig Control System technology options
  • Make regular field and customer visits to ensure the company is informed of the latest market trends and future industry needs.
  • Provide product support and technical training to the field sales team.
  • Prepare and organize suitable training/training material to assist in the development of the sales force.
  • Monitor competitor activities and understand their products
  • Travel as required to fulfill the duties of the role and this includes travel on weekends or overseas to the factories in USA ,and Sweden and to mine sites and customer’s offices across Canada.
  • Full responsibility for Automation financials.
